If you see him, call police

The mother of a man who RCMP believe committed a murder in Lac La Biche, Alta. back in October 2017 was arrested on Saturday.

Margaret Simon, 53, was arrested and charged with accessory to murder in the homicide of Michael Mountain.

At about 4:30 a.m. on Oct. 28, 2017, police found a man suffering from a gunshot wound and transported him to hospital where he succumbed to his injuries.

A Canada-wide warrant was issued for Lloyd Wesley Boudreau on Nov. 7, 2017 in connection with the crime. He is wanted for first degree murder, as well as evading police and disposing of physical evidence of the crime.

Police believe Simon assisted Boudreau, and she is expected to appear in Lac La Biche Provincial Court Monday.

Police have been searching Lac La Biche, St. Paul, Boyle, Camrose, Edmonton and the Kamloops area for Boudreau.

Boudreau is likely with a woman named Mandi Leigh Boucher, 25, of Buffalo Lake Metis Settlement. She was reported missing the same day Mountain’s body was found.

Police said Boudreau is 188 lbs, 5'6", with black hair and brown eyes. He has tattoos on his neck and the right side of his face. Boucher is 150 lbs, around 5'1", with brown hair and green eyes.

Police believe Boudreau is armed and dangerous and anyone who knows his whereabouts should contact RCMP.
